Máster Universitario en Profesorado en Educación Secundaria Obrigatoria, Bacharelato, Formación Profesional e Ensino de Idiomas. Especialidade: Arte. Debuxo
To enhance the development of the individual capabilities of each Secondary Education Master student and to respond to their different interests and specialisation profiles, personalised attention will be given to resolve doubts, to advise on strategies to improve oral expression, to correct common errors when making public presentations, and to suggest references for expanding or reinforcing all topics covered.
If the development of a lesson allows it, especially during the different guided practices, individualised attention will be provided by pooling doubts, making individual corrections and encouraging participation in class. In any case, students would always be able to request support via Internet, for which agile communication channels such as forums, blogs or email will be facilitated.
